When your cat throws up whole kibble – Gatto vomita crocchette intere
Cats often regurgitate dry food undigested because they gulp it down too fast or the pieces swell dramatically in the stomach. Hairballs and low-grade gastritis make it worse. Feed smaller portions four or five times a day, switch to a slow-feed bowl, add a spoon of wet food on top so they actually chew, and brush daily to cut down swallowed hair. Frequent episodes or weight loss mean it’s time for blood work and possibly an abdominal scan.
Helping a limping dog at home – Cane che zoppica rimedi naturali
For minor sprains or old-age stiffness, enforce total rest, apply ice the first two days then switch to warm compresses, give high-quality fish oil, homemade turmeric paste, and proven joint supplements (glucosamine + chondroitin + MSM). Never use human painkillers – they can be deadly. Any sudden, severe, or persistent limp needs X-rays and a vet to exclude fractures, torn ligaments, or tick diseases.
How often to deworm your dog – Vermifugo cani
Start puppies every 14 days until 12 weeks old, then monthly until 6 months. Adults need treatment every 3 months minimum, or monthly if they scavenge, eat raw meat, or live with small children. Safe and effective options are Milbemax, Drontal Plus, Advocate spot-on, and Panacur. Always weigh the dog accurately before giving the tablet.
Red, hot ears in dogs – Orecchie rosse cane
Inflamed, smelly, or crusty ears almost always signal yeast, bacteria, allergies, or ear mites (very common in young dogs). Avoid sticking anything deep into the canal. Gently clean with a proper veterinary ear solution only and book a check-up fast – left untreated, these infections become excruciating and can destroy hearing.
Rapidly growing fatty lumps – Lipoma cane crescita veloce
Classic lipomas are harmless, movable, soft lumps that appear gradually in chubby middle-aged dogs. When a lump pops up overnight or grows noticeably within days or weeks, it could be an aggressive mast cell tumour or sarcoma. Fast changes in size, firmness, or shape demand urgent vet investigation and usually a needle biopsy.

Keeping long-haired cats mat-free – Toelettatura gatti
Short-haired cats rarely need help, but Persians, Maine Coons, Ragdolls, and seniors quickly tangle. Brush several times weekly with a wide comb followed by a slicker brush. Professional grooming every 4–8 weeks prevents painful knots. Never lion-cut or shave a cat unless a vet insists – their skin damages extremely easily.
Using vinegar against dog dandruff – Forfora cane aceto
A simple rinse of one part raw apple cider vinegar to one part water after shampooing can calm light, dry flaking by rebalancing skin pH. It does nothing for oily, smelly, or very itchy scales caused by allergies, thyroid issues, or mites. Always do a patch test – vinegar stings raw skin.
Choosing the right probiotic for dogs – Probiotico cane
Dog-specific products containing Enterococcus faecium and several Lactobacillus strains are the gold standard for restoring gut flora after antibiotics, during stress, or with chronic diarrhoea. Top veterinary choices include FortiFlora, Pro-Kolin, and Synbiotic D-C. Regular human yoghurt rarely has enough live cultures and sometimes contains xylitol, which is poisonous.
How dog warts actually look – Verruche cane immagini
Young dogs frequently develop clusters of rough, grey-white, cauliflower-shaped viral papillomas on lips, gums, and eyelids – these vanish by themselves in 1–6 months. Older dogs can grow similar-looking harmless sebaceous bumps or malignant tumours. Google “canine oral papillomatosis” for clear photos. Any lone, bleeding, ulcerated, or fast-enlarging growth in an adult dog must be examined and possibly removed.
